> > NACK to this change. The virt-viewer GIT codebase must *always* build
> > against the latest stable Fedora releases. F20 only has 0.22, so this
> > change must not be made unless F20 gets a newer spice-gtk release in
> > its stable updates repo.
> > 
> 
> This is either asking for latest spice-gtk in f20, which can be a
> bit risky, or waiting for a few cycles. Is this really the way to
> handle development of such tight projects?

Yes, I think it is important that the code is able to build on the
current stable release of Fedora. All the formal releases including
the windows binary packages are created using whatever the current
stable release is at the time of release.

A third way is to make the code conditional on existance of the newer
version using a equiv of GTK_CHECK_VERSION() for spice-gtk version
checks.

> Imho, it would be nicer if at least, you would consider virt-viewer
> master to build with rawhide.

rawhide is far too unstable to consider it a viable development
or testing platform in general and I certainly don't ever want
to be shipping stuff from rawhide in the binary windows packages
we release.
